Our client’s primary mission is to support the development of graduate and certificate-program students’ writing, critical thinking, and academic skills. These services enhance students’ discipline-based learning, improve the quality of their academic work and help them complete their educational goals.
The successful Advanced Graduate Writing Instructor will join a team of Writing Instructors, and Thesis Processors, to provide one-to-one instruction focused on developing students’ writing, critical thinking, and other academic skills. Other services offered by the team include workshops, academic department-based courses, online guides and learning tools, and support with non-academic and multimodal writing.

Responsibilities:
- Provide one-to-one writing instruction support to graduate students
- Occasionally conduct research related to writing, critical thinking, program effectiveness, and special topics such as generative artificial intelligence’s (AI) impact on teaching and learning
- Edit faculty papers, faculty executive summaries and technical reports per year
- Analyze student papers for plagiarism, and create & maintained online learning and communication materials
- Develop and deliver 60- to 90-minute hands-on workshops and general presentations for students and faculty
- Support students in understanding academic norms and graduate-level standards with respect to writing, organizing thoughts, writing to conform to advanced presentation of arguments and evidence, brainstorming, outlining, revising, citing/attribution, ethical use and disclosure of generative AI, and interpreting and presenting data effectively
- Accommodate varying student needs and required support
- Review student papers 2 to 24 hours before appointments to: prioritize issues based on student requests and needs, review reports on students’ past appointments, develop consultation strategies
- Complete student client reports, short summaries of issues covered and progress made
